# 更新限时抢购任务

接口应在服务器端调用,不可在前端(小程序、网页、APP等)直接调用,具体可参考接口调用指南

接口英文名:updatelimiteddiscounttask

可通过该接口更新限时抢购任务

# 1. 调用方式

# HTTPS 调用

POST https://api.weixin.qq.com/channels/ec/product/limiteddiscounttask/update?access_token=ACCESS_TOKEN

# 云调用

  • 本接口不支持云调用。

# 第三方调用

# 2. 请求参数

# 查询参数 Query String Parameters

参数名类型必填示例说明
access_token-ACCESS_TOKEN接口调用凭证,可使用 access_token(微信小店商家)、authorizer_access_token(服务商代调用)

# 请求体 Request Payload

参数名类型必填说明
task_idstring限时抢购任务ID
statusnumber当前活动状态(乐观锁校验,传入时校验与实际状态是否一致。0=待开始, 1=进行中)
start_timenumber限时抢购任务开始时间(秒级时间戳)
end_timenumber限时抢购任务结束时间(秒级时间戳)
titlestring活动名称(仅商家可见,最长50个字符)
limited_discount_skusobjarraySKU抢购信息列表,修改SKU时必须传入product_id

# Body.limited_discount_skus(Array) Object Payload

SKU抢购信息列表,修改SKU时必须传入product_id

参数名类型必填说明
product_idstringSKU所属商品ID(修改SKU时必传)
sku_idstringSKU ID
sale_pricenumberSKU的抢购价格
sale_stocknumber参与抢购的商品库存

# 3. 返回参数

# 返回体 Response Payload

参数名类型说明
errcodenumber错误码
errmsgnumber错误信息
task_idnumber限时抢购任务ID
titlestring活动名称

# 4. 注意事项

  1. 只能更新待开始(status=0)或进行中(status=1)的活动,已结束的活动无法修改
  2. 不支持修改限购设置(is_limit_purchase 和 limit_purchase_num),限购需在创建活动时设置
  3. 活动持续时间不可超过7天
  4. start_time 不得超过当前时间90天以后
  5. end_time 必须大于当前时间
  6. 修改 SKU 时,每个 SKU 必须传入 product_id 标识所属商品
  7. 传入 status 时会校验与活动实际状态是否一致,不一致返回错误(用于防止并发更新)

# 5. 代码示例

请求示例

{
    "task_id": "12345678",
    "status": 0,
    "title": "新活动名称",
    "end_time": 1614873822,
    "limited_discount_skus": [
        {
            "product_id": "1234567001",
            "sku_id": "12345678901",
            "sale_price": 2888,
            "sale_stock": 5
        }
    ]
}

返回示例

{
    "errcode": 0,
    "errmsg": "ok",
    "task_id": "12345678",
    "title": "新活动名称"
}

# 6. 错误码

以下是本接口的错误码列表,其他错误码可参考 通用错误码;调用接口遇到报错,可使用官方提供的 API 诊断工具 辅助定位和分析问题。

错误码错误描述
10020072活动时长不能超过7天
10020074设置抢购的SKU无效
10020076抢购活动不存在
10020077抢购活动状态不正确(已结束的活动无法修改)
10020514活动状态与入参不一致,请刷新后重试
10020516活动名称超过最大长度限制
10020517限时抢购入参错误(如传入了不支持修改的限购设置,或修改SKU时未传product_id)

# 7. 适用范围

本接口支持「微信小店」账号类型调用。其他账号类型如无特殊说明,均不可调用。

接口变更日志(1条)
2026 年 05 月 12 日
新增 更新限时抢购任务 接口